This is through and through a group hug deck designed to make the game more fun! As you can probably tell from the deck list there aren't many options when it comes to winning, but the main objective of the deck is to have fun, not win! With plenty of card draw, mana ramp, and damage prevention this deck has you act as a judge, helping who you see fit especially with cards like Avacyn, Guardian Angel you have the potential to allow someone to make a big comeback.

Most of this deck is comprised of cards that help people, whether it's one person or everyone depends but for the most part everyone will benefit from card draw likeOtherworld Atlas,Dictate of Kruphix,Rites of Flourishing,Howling Mine,Fecundity, Noble Benefactor , Indentured Djinn ,Temple Bell,Kami of the Crescent Moon,Ghirapur Orrery, Prosperity ,Windfall

And with land rampDictate of Karametra, Magus of the Vineyard ,Rites of Flourishing,Veteran Explorer, New Frontiers , Eladamri's Vineyard , Shizuko, Caller of Autumn

And a small amount of damage prevention Benevolent Unicorn , Chameleon Blur , Benefactor's Draught , Avacyn, Guardian Angel ,AEtherize, Polymorphist's Jest , Trap Runner

With playing a group hug deck comes the inevitability of a weak board, meaning we will be open to most attacks that come our way. In order to defend ourselves cards like Propaganda and Ghostly Prison have been added, and Sphere of Safety can get to extreme amounts of mana per attacker. The deck also has cards like Spiritual Asylum in order to keep our precious creatures safe, and Karmic Justice to keep people from blowing up our enchantments and artifacts.
Group hug decks are all about diplomacy, seeming to not be a threat and to help the right person out at the right time. Now being a group hug deck doesn't mean that you can't end somebody's life however, let's say that a Ghoulcaller Gisa deck is attacking all in to kill a player. What you're able to do is play Chameleon Blur or use Avacyn, Guardian Angel ability to save them and who, during their turn, will most likely destroy the gisa player. But until that happens you want to help everyone to take aggro off of yourself. Somebody attacks you? Give them some hippos or health. Somebody attacks somebody else? Give everyone 10 extra mana. The one way to win with this deck is milling, and by the time there's one person left (aside from yourself) you should be able to cast a lethal Prosperity . HOWEVER do not do this often! I cannot stress it enough, if you play with people they tend to remember what has happened in the past. As a group hug deck it's sometimes best to let the other person win.
